Output 752892467b0c8abb091b8c42159db4c6a737d78bdfa2a104c04cd26e18429884:0

value
49063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caf043061c8c0aea81a4ab97afbba5a41b779e5d OP_EQUAL
address
3LC4EycQ6TW8gHs1KrtjyRA2oDB6ftSdRF
transaction
752892467b0c8abb091b8c42159db4c6a737d78bdfa2a104c04cd26e18429884
spent
true